The Colombian Industrial Landscape & Occupational Safety Demands

Colombia's economy is undergoing a massive structural shift. High-intensity sectors such as mining in La Guajira and Cesar (home to Latin America's largest open-cast coal mines), gold extraction in Antioquia, and major infrastructure initiatives like the Bogotá Metro Line 1 and 4G/5G Highway Networks have significantly increased exposure to hazardous airborne particulate matter.

Under the national regulatory framework managed by the Ministry of Labor (specifically Resolution 0312 of 2019 establishing the SGSST occupational health system), companies are legally obligated to provide certified personal protective equipment (PPE) that matches the toxicological and physical properties of regional contaminants.

  • Silicosis Mitigation: Crucial for workers exposed to silica dust in civil works and concrete processing.
  • Organic Vapor Safeguards: Imperative for flower cultivation across the Sabana de Bogotá utilizing chemical fertilizers.
  • Certified Compliance: Strictly aligning with ICONTEC standards (NTC 3852 & NTC 2561) and international equivalencies (NIOSH N95 / EN 149 FFP2/FFP3).

Optimizing Tariffs and Regulatory Clearances

Navigating Colombia's DIAN (Dirección de Impuestos y Aduanas Nacionales) requirements is essential for smooth logistics. Mask imports generally fall under HS Code 6307.90.30.00 (disposable masks) or similar PPE classifications. Depending on the current bilateral trade agreements and temporary decrees, tariffs and VAT (IVA) rates may vary.

Additionally, if the masks are intended for medical or clinical applications, they must comply with INVIMA sanitary registration requirements. However, masks imported strictly as industrial PPE (Non-medical certifications) require conformity certificates proving compliance with EN 149 or NIOSH standards, bypassing clinical registry hurdles. Shipping Timelines & Port Infrastructure

For shipments departing from our facilities in Zhejiang, China, we coordinate directly with ports in Ningbo and Shanghai. The primary maritime lanes serving the Colombian market include:

  • Pacific Port (Buenaventura): The fastest transit corridor, with shipping times between 28 to 35 days. Excellent for distribution in Cali, Medellín, and Bogotá.
  • Atlantic Ports (Cartagena & Barranquilla): Direct transit via the Panama Canal, taking 32 to 40 days. The preferred route for coastal industrial zones and northern mining operations.

Q1: What are the key differences between FFP3, FFP2, and N95 masks used in Colombian industrial environments? +
These ratings refer to the filtration performance under different testing standards. N95 is a US NIOSH standard requiring at least 95% filtration of non-oily aerosols. FFP2 is a European EN 149 standard requiring at least 94% filtration of both oily and non-oily particles. FFP3 represents the highest level of protection under EN 149, capturing at least 99% of particulate matter, making it the preferred choice for underground mining, silica mitigation in construction, and chemical-heavy processes.
Q2: Do non-medical dust protection masks require an INVIMA registry in Colombia? +
No. Under Colombian health regulations, only masks classified as medical devices (surgical masks, clinical respirators used in operating theatres) require an active INVIMA sanitary registry. Masks imported for industrial dust protection, mining, and construction are classified as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) and do not fall under INVIMA's medical remit. Instead, they require a Certificate of Conformity to show they meet international safety standards (EN 149 / NIOSH).

Q6: How do active carbon layers improve safety in agricultural sectors? +
Active carbon masks are ideal for agricultural applications, such as coffee processing or flower cultivation, where workers are exposed to dust alongside mild organic vapors, pesticides, or fertilizers. The carbon layer acts as an adsorbent, capturing volatile organic compounds (VOCs) and neutralizing unpleasant odors, while the outer layers filter out physical dust and liquid droplets.
